As Ceres, the asteroid famously associated with nurturing and sustenance, pirouettes through the sensitive sign of Cancer, it strikes up a rather peculiar conversation with your natal Mars in Sagittarius. The quincunx aspect is like two people at a party who can't quite vibe with each other's energy-Mars is ready to dance on tables while Ceres would much rather sit down and pass around the appetizers.

This cosmic dance could leave you feeling as if you're trying to feed a newborn while simultaneously training for a marathon. Ceres in Cancer wants to swaddle and protect, urging you to tend to the home fires, bake some cookies, and ensure everyone is emotionally fulfilled. On the flip side, your fiery Sagittarian Mars is itching to throw caution to the wind and gallop off into the sunset in search of truth, wisdom, or at the very least, a decent adventure that doesn't involve a diaper bag.

The trick here is to find the right recipe that blends the Cancerian comfort food with the spicy zest of Sagittarian exploration.
